LU分解在Godson-Tvl众核体系结构上的半行化研究
随着集成电路工艺的发展,众核体系结构成为人们日益关注的计算平台.LU分解是科学和工程计算中被广泛使用的核心算法之一,尽管在传统的并行体系结构上已有大量的并行化研究工作,但是结合新犁众核体系结构特征的工作还不多.文章从负载均衡、延迟容忍和性能分析模型3个方面系统研究了LU分解在众核体系结构上的并行化问题.该文的贡献在于:首先,针对二维卷帘负载分配方案难以达到良好负载均衡的缺点,提出一种新的"之"字形分配方案,实验表明不经任何优化的情况下性能比前者提高20%,优化后达到了40%;其次,提出了一个性能加速比的分析模型,并用实验定量研究了实测性能加速比和理论值之间的差距,发现在合理利用片上存储优化访存延迟,并恰当选择矩阵分块参数的情况下,实测加速效果能比较接近理论值;通过实验还证明实测性能难以达到理论预测值的两个主要原因:访存带宽有限和片上网络的资源竞争.
众核体系结构、LU分解、并行化、延迟容忍、性能模型
32
TP302(计算技术、计算机技术)
国家"九七三"重点基础研究发展规划项目基金2005CB321600;国家自然科学基金重点项目60736012;国家"八六三"高技术研究发展计划项目基金2009AA01Z103;国家杰出青年科学基金和北京市自然科学基金4092044
2010-01-15(万方平台首次上网日期,不代表论文的发表时间)
共11页
2157-2167